Summary

This chapter concludes the J2ME Polish part of this book. In this chapter, I discussed the various ways you can extend J2ME Polish—including integrating your own preprocessor and other build tools, creating your own GUI elements, and extending the logging framework.

In the following part, you will take a close look at the real world of J2ME programming. Sadly, a difference always exists between the theoretical standard and the actual implementations of the J2ME environments on real phones. In the next part, you will learn how you can adjust your application to the various real-world issues while still delivering a top-notch application.
